Most leadership development sits in one of two camps. You either get the hard-charging, metrics-driven approach that treats people as resources to be optimized, or you get the soft, feel-good content that leaves leaders inspired for a day and unchanged by the next week. I don't do either of those things. After more than two decades leading people strategy inside organizations like Amazon, Zappos, and UofL Health, I know what it takes to build teams that actually perform at a high level. I also know what it costs when leaders get that wrong. I have seen burnout, attrition, and broken cultures up close, and I have navigated them from the inside, not from a consulting deck. What makes my work different is that I bring the whole picture. I believe sustainable performance and human wellbeing are not competing priorities. They are the same priority, approached from different angles. That belief is not theoretical. It comes from my own life, including my work co-founding Salt Wellness and my years studying holistic approaches to human performance. I have lived the tension between achievement and sustainability, and I have figured out how to hold both. When I work with leaders and organizations, I bring that full perspective into the room. My sessions are experiential, honest, and grounded in what actually works. Audiences leave with more than a framework. They leave with a shift in how they see their role, their team, and themselves. Leading from Within: The New Standard for Leadership
The most effective leaders are not the loudest voices in the room or the ones with the most authority. They are the ones who know themselves well enough to lead others with clarity, intention, and trust. This interactive session helps leaders move from reactive to intentional, building the self-awareness and adaptability that high-performing teams actually need from the people leading them. Participants leave with a clearer understanding of how their inner landscape shapes the culture around them, and what to do about it. What participants walk away with - A practical framework for building self-awareness as a leadership discipline - Strategies for leading with clarity and steadiness during uncertainty and change - Concrete tools for deepening communication and trust across their teams
The Human Side of High Performance
High performance is not just a function of strategy, systems, or talent. It is a function of how safe people feel, how trusted they feel, and how connected they feel to the work and to each other. This session bridges leadership science and human-centered practice, giving leaders the tools to build environments where accountability and compassion are not opposites. Organizations that get this right do not just perform well. They sustain it. What participants walk away with - A reframe of performance that puts trust and psychological safety at the center - Behaviors and practices that sustain high performance without burning people out - Approaches for building resilience and connection as leadership essentials, not afterthoughts
Thriving Beyond Burnout: Reimagining Leadership Well-Being
Leaders are expected to bring energy, empathy, and endurance to their work every single day. Most do. What they rarely do is replenish what they give. This session invites leaders to rethink their relationship with wellbeing, not as a personal indulgence but as a professional responsibility. Through honest reflection and practical tools, participants learn how integrating wellness into their leadership creates stronger teams, healthier cultures, and the kind of sustainable success that does not come at a cost they cannot afford. What participants walk away with - The ability to recognize early signs of leadership fatigue before they become a crisis - A clear model for prioritizing wellbeing without compromising accountability or results - Sustainable habits and practices that protect performance, clarity, and longevity as a leader
